Looks like it'll be a good bit 'down the road' if it doesn't just turn out to be ...Technically, you only have one station broadcasting in ATSC 3.0 in your market, WUHF. Its ATSC 3.0 transmission carries the programming from WROC, WHAM and WXXI. This is why all of those stations' readings are identical. It lets you view over-the-air programs via your home router and Wi-Fi or Ethernet connection.Tuning - ATSC 3.0 requires a multi-step approach to tuning that can take a little longer than ATSC 1.0. Not a major factor. Protocol layers - ATSC 3.0 has more protocol layers which each have their own sync points. How much this impacts the tune time depends on the broadcast equipment.The HDHomeRun Connect 4K became the first ATSC 3.0 tuner for consumers when it launched last fall. ... While one tuner is being used to watch TV, the other tuner is used in the background to keep updating guide data being received over the air on other frequencies. This way, whenever you press the guide button, you see the most current guide data.2. ATSC 3.0 is slower to tune than ATSC 1.0, most due to the key frame interval increasing from 0.5s to 2s between ATSC 1.0 and 3.0.Dolby AC-4: ATSC 3.0 uses the Dolby AC-4 standard while ATSC 1.0 is based on the older Dolby AC-3 audio standard. The old standard offers Dolby 5.1 surround sound while Dolby AC-4 offers Dolby 7.1.4 three-dimensional sound also known as Dolby Atmos. Zapperbox has a new update that can decode DRM but Zapperbox is 1:1 device. Home run Flex can do multiple devices on the same home network. Can't record DRM content yet but able to record ATSC 1.0. Zapperbox costs more though. Both have paid subscription for DVR services.ZapperBox ATSC 3.0 4K setup box will be available for $249. : r/cordcutters. Just announced!
